删除 Glut/FreeGlut/GLFW 的控制台窗口?
在 Visual C++ 下,我尝试过 Glut/FreeGlut/GLFW。似乎所有这些项目都默认添加了一个 CMD 窗口。我尝试将其删除: 属性->C/C++->预处理器->预处理器 …
关于如何使用 OpenGL/GLUT 建模建筑物的想法?
我是图形学新手,我必须仅使用 GLUT 或 OpenGL 为作业制作一个建筑物模型。 基本上要制作校舍的模型(仅外部部分),但我不知道从哪里开始。到目前为…
在过剩的显示功能中使用对象
我在使用过剩 DisplayFunction 中的对象时遇到问题。 class Modelisation { private: int hauteur, largeur, x, y; Camera *Cam; void DisplayFunctio…
OpenGL粒子系统
我正在尝试使用 OpenGl 模拟粒子系统,但我无法让它工作,这就是我到目前为止所拥有的: #include int main (int argc, char **argv){ // data alloca…
在多个文件中使用 Glew
不知何故,我无法在多个头文件中获取 Glew。它只是抱怨 Gl 已经在 GLEW 之前定义了。 简而言之,我有以下文件结构: Program.h 包括:、 和 "SceneMan…
freeglut 中对象的回调函数
我使用 MSVC++ 和 freeglut 来使用 openGL。现在,我有一个名为 Camera 的类,它非常简单,但它还包含重塑窗口形状的功能。 我的问题是:如何将 glutR…
如果没有管理员权限,我应该将 freeglut.dll 留在哪里?
我已经在Visual Studio 2008中安装了freeglut来使用openGL进行开发。但是在构建后播放exe时,找不到freeglut.dll。这是非常合乎逻辑的,因为我还没有…
使用 glutStrokeString 而不是 glutBitmapString 时出现问题
我正在编写我的第一个 OpenGL 程序(使用 freeglut 用 C 语言)。我的显示函数中有以下代码,该代码运行良好并打印出灰色文本: glColor3f(0.5f, 0.5f…
sdl_gl_setattribute 上的 sdl 应用程序段错误
我正在尝试编译此 示例并尝试一下。我已经纠正了人们在这个示例中遇到的主要错误,即他们会在调用 SDL_Init 之前调用 sdl_gl_setattribute,但在第一…
opengl离屏渲染
我在 MAC OS X 10.6 上使用 opengl FBO 和 glut 进行离屏渲染。该程序涉及多个 3D 对象的移动。 该程序似乎工作正常,除了我需要包含一个选项,其中屏…
海湾合作委员会 C++ FC13 上的链接器部分
我正在尝试让 OpenGL 和 Glut 在 Eclipse Linux FC13 上运行。 经过两天的研究,我承认需要帮助。在 FC13 Eclipse 上,我看到 /usr/include/GL 和 /us…
使用 FreeGLUT,如何创建 OpenGL 窗口,指定标题和屏幕位置?
FreeGLUT API 有几个窗口管理功能: int glutCreateWindow(const char * title ); int glutCreateSubWindow(int window, int x, int y, int width, in…
跨 Linux 发行版编译时的 OpenGL 问题
我最近用 opengl(使用 freeglut)编写了一个迷宫游戏,在 Ubuntu 或 Cygwin 中构建时运行良好,但是当使用 freeglut 在 Fedora Core 12 上构建时,游…